
SoftBank to discontinue Otoku Line copper service from 2030

SoftBank announced that after 31 March 2030, its "Otoku Line" fixed-line telephone service will be discontinued. From 31 March 2026, SoftBank will no longer accept new applications. The operator began providing Otoku Line in 2004 as a fixed-line telephone service that utilises the dry copper wires and dark fibres of NTT East and NTT West and the service has since been used by many customers.
